— Tucker Pennell had a three-run double and Jake Arledge added a solo home run to extend Arkansas' fall scrimmage series Saturday.

Their hits helped the White team to a 5-4 win in Game 3 of the series. The Red team leads the best-of-five series 2-1.

Pennell's hit capped a four-run third inning against pitcher Zach Jackson, but all four runs were unearned. The inning began with an error and the White team took a 1-0 lead on Clark Eagan's sacrifice fly.

Arledge's home run extended the lead to 5-0 in the fourth inning.

Jack Benninghoff had two RBI hits, while Eric Cole and Austin Catron each added one RBI hit in the late innings to pull the Red team within 5-4. Luke Bonfield grounded out with the tying run at third base in the ninth inning.

All three games in the series have been decided by one run.

Freshman right-hander Blaine Knight pitched four scoreless innings to earn the win. Jackson struck out two batters in 2 2/3 innings and was the losing pitcher.

Game 4 will be played Sunday at 3 p.m. The scrimmages are open to the public free of charge.
